I was just talking with my friend who used to play this game, but he stopped when he lost his save file when he updated his game, not just launcher, to 0.25. When the next update comes around, I'm afraid I may lose my data. Is there a reason this happens and is there way it can be prevented?

The game is still in Indev status & things like this are bound to happen, to prevent it, try to keep a backup file everytime you update your game.

Well as far as I know even the devs are confused about this because it isn't suppose to happen, well obviosuly, but what I mean is the updates are not supposed to touch the save folder at all. I'm still skeptical about this being a bug with the game though. I've never experienced this problem myself and I started at version 0.18, so I have been through quite a few updates.

As a safety measure, I suggest you do what Enethil said. I do this myself each time a new update comes around, just to be sure.

Just go into the Pokemon folder, then into save, Copy the folder with your character's name on it & put it somewhere else on your computer.

What do you do with the back up folder after the new update? Do you paste it back into the new save file to restore your data?

Well for starters I would run the game first to check if the savefiles were still working properly. In the event that I don't see a savefile, I would first check if there even exists a save folder in the Pokemon folder. If the folder did not exist or was empty, i'd paste the backup of my save folder into the Pokemon folder.
